Legendary Hotel changes hands
The legendary Plaza Hotel has been sold to Indian billionaire Subrata Roy for $575 million dollars.
Subrata’s Sahara group was purchased from Israeli-owned realtor El Ad US Holdings and is co-owned by Kingdom Holding, which retains a 25% stake in the property.
The hotel. which was built in 1907, was renovated in 2008 and now contains 282 hotel rooms and 152 private condominium units. It is managed by Fairmont Hotels and Resorts.
